A nettilslutningsaftale, also known as a net-metering agreement, is a contractual arrangement between a utility company and a consumer or a group of consumers, typically in the context of renewable energy generation. This agreement allows consumers to generate their own electricity, often through solar panels or wind turbines, and feed any excess electricity back into the grid. The utility company then credits the consumer for the electricity they generate and use, effectively offsetting their electricity bills.
